Here in Middlesex, we experience the full swing of Eastern North Carolina seasons—humid summers and occasionally chilly winters. A great local boarding facility will have climate-controlled environments year-round, ensuring your cat is comfortable whether it's 95 degrees in July or a brisk 35-degree January night. When touring a potential spot, ask about their temperature management and if they have backup power for our occasional summer storms. A facility that plans for our local weather is one that plans for pet safety.
Beyond climate, look for boarding that caters to a cat's sensitive nature. Cats are territorial and can stress easily in new environments. The best options will offer quiet spaces away from barking dogs, plenty of vertical spaces to perch, and consistent daily routines. Don't hesitate to ask if you can bring your cat's own blanket, a favorite toy, or even their usual brand of food from the Middlesex Piggly Wiggly to provide comforting familiarity.
When evaluating your search for "cat boarding near me," a personal visit is invaluable. Check for cleanliness, secure enclosures, and observe the staff's demeanor. Do they ask detailed questions about your cat's personality and health? Are they willing to administer medication if needed? Local, smaller facilities often provide that personalized, attentive care that makes all the difference.
Preparing for boarding is key. Ensure your cat's vaccinations are up-to-date, as required by most North Carolina facilities. Pack a clear care instruction sheet and provide your vet's contact information.
